Abstract
In this paper, a DCT-based multipurpose image watermarking algorithm is proposed. Through adopting dither modulation in subimages gained by subsampling, two independent robust watermarks can be embedded in the original image. Experimental results demonstrate the effectiveness of the proposed algorithm.
